Following up on the current events, the MB is aware
that among its duties is to clarify its position
regarding the developments taking place at the
internal, regional, and global levels as well as its
stance on the Arab-Zionist conflict.
Based on this, the MB affirms its fixed stance on
several issues such as resistance, national security,
the nature of the conflict, and Zionist interests in
the region.
The issue recently raised in media and political
circles, at the local and regional level, known as the
“Hezbollah cell in Egypt,” has exposed the nation’s
need for unification in the face of the Israeli
occupation seeking to disturb its security and
stability.
This necessitates that we determine who our friends
and foes are, and the role of resistance in Palestine,
Iraq, and other Arab and Islamic countries in
defending Arab national security in general and
Egyptian national security in particular, a matter
which requires the whole nation, institutions and
people, to support resistance morally, financially,
and in fact, martially in application of the Joint
Arab Defense agreement. It is illogical that America
provide the Zionist entity with all forms of support
in addition to its possession of a nuclear arsenal
while Palestinians be left unarmed in the face of
siege, death, and destruction. At the same time, we
affirm that the nation’s support for resistance must
take place within the context of coordination and
collaboration between all the Arab and Islamic
countries. No one can disagree with Hezbollah’s aim
of supporting Palestinian resistance; however, means
of support must not be mixed with any form of
individual acts.
We view this issue as one of Zionists’ attempts to
weaken the Arab-Islamic nation by creating
inter-Arab/Islamic conflicts to divert the nation’s
attention from the true Arab/Islamic-Zionist
conflict. By this Zionists also seek to cover up on
their war crimes against humanity in Gaza and to foil
Gaza rebuilding programs. All this calls on us to pay
attention to the true nature of the conflict and not
to allow differences and side issues that have been
raised recently distract us from our major issues.
The MB affirm their support for resistance as they see
in it the hope of the oppressed and the nation’s
symbol of pride and dignity. This support, however,
doesn’t conflict with MB’s keenness on Egyptian
national security and countries’ sovereignty over
their lands. Hence, the MB emphasize the necessity
that the Egyptian government protect its national
security by establishing justice, combating
corruption, and supporting resistance, then by
confronting those who tamper with this security; this
is why cooperating with those who intend to harm our
countries is actually helping the American-Zionist
project to succeed at penetrating the Islamic and Arab
nation, especially Egypt.
